It took me 11 months to create the the first release of Pocket Tanks. That included 60 weapons and two separate versions of the game... shareware and deluxe.

Super DX-Ball was in development for 2 years, and that included all the new boards plus the 2 separate versions.

If you were to add up all the time I spend making the 1.1 and 1.2 updates for Pocket Tanks, that would add up to about another 6 to 8 months of development time. If you throw in the time I've spent 'trying' to add network play to Pocket Tanks, that would probably be another 4 to 6 months of coding. (that is just an estimate, since I hate thinking about the how much time was lost on the network code) :)

Roughly...
Pocket Tanks = ~2 years
Super DX-Ball = ~2 years

If you throw in the expansion packs, the numbers look more like this:
Pocket Tanks = ~3.0 years
Super DX-Ball = ~2.2 years

Moving forward... network play is seeing some great progress and I have plenty of updates for Pocket Tanks planned. But to bring balance to the force, I hope to get the opportunity to update Super DX-Ball and make some expansions in the next few months.
